Transaction 6edbc586c8754bcde77225063c7ed86a297cd24b0d121d675fc2e2ef4ab194c5

1 Input
1 Outputs
  • 6edbc586c8754bcde77225063c7ed86a297cd24b0d121d675fc2e2ef4ab194c5:0
  • value  142963
    address  34Ttht16uqbNiq2HGGiR6Rax54ETeGJZgQ